The 40Hp and under tractors are all in critical short supply right now. The Kubota dealer near me is full of tractors over 60hp and looks empty on the subcompacts and compacts.

Your tractor being a 55Hp model was probably in stock, at their field storage in Wendell, NC. From there, your tractor is shipped as multiple pallets to a Kioti regional assembly site, and then from there is shipped directly to your dealer fully assembled. All your dealer does, is final preparation and makes delivery and registration of your tractor for warranty. So yes the three weeks sounds reasonable during a Pandemic. Your dealer should know the exact status of your order, at any moment in time.

Just to reiterate, Kioti do not ship a fully assembled tractor from NC storage directly to your dealer. It goes through a kioti regional assembly site. This is what the Kioti regional assembly site serving Texas dealers looks like. It only does assembly.

When I left the New Holland / Kioti dealership in NY in 2017 all Kioti wholegoods were distributed from Wendell, NC and a location in Texas direct to dealers, either assembled or crated. All parts for the US were distributed from Wendell, NC.
Maybe that has changed, maybe it has not.

Many distribution channels are seriously disrupted in this Covid affected world. Kioti is far from alone in its struggle to keep dealers stocked.
